Insider Travel Tips
Practical tips for Mata-Utu — sourced from official tourism guidance and Wallis and Futuna travel advisories:
Beat the Crowds
Visit the local markets early in the morning to enjoy a more authentic experience and avoid the midday rush.
Money Saving Secret
Consider dining at local food stalls instead of restaurants to enjoy delicious traditional meals at a fraction of the cost.
Local Phrase
Learn to say 'Malo' (thank you) in Wallisian to connect with the locals and show appreciation for their hospitality.
Best Time to Visit
The best time to visit is during the dry season from May to October when the weather is pleasant and ideal for outdoor activities.

🗓️ Best Time to Visit
Peak Season
July-September
🌡️ 24-28°C
This is the dry season with the best weather for outdoor activities and cultural festivals.
Shoulder Season
May-June, October-November
🌡️ 22-26°C
These months offer pleasant weather and fewer tourists, making it a great time to explore.
Off Season
December-April
🌡️ 25-30°C
This is the wet season with higher humidity and occasional storms, but it can still be a beautiful time to visit.
